Case Study & Real-World Insights: Why Timely HVAC Repairs Matter
Case Study: Preventing a Costly Breakdown
Issue: A homeowner in Sunny Isles Beach, FL experienced:
Uneven cooling and high energy bills.
AC struggling to maintain comfortable temperatures.
Diagnosis:
Clogged evaporator coil reducing efficiency.
Failing capacitor forcing the system to work harder.
Solution:
Thorough system cleaning.
Coil maintenance and capacitor replacement.
Results:
Cooling performance restored.
Energy use dropped by 15%, saving $400/year.
Prevented a $3,000+ system replacement.
Real-World Example: The Cost of Delayed Repairs
Scenario: A business owner ignored minor HVAC issues.
What Happened:
Poor airflow and inefficient cooling affected customer comfort.
Compressor failed, leading to a $2,500 emergency repair.
What Could Have Prevented It:
A $200 routine maintenance check would have identified the problem early.

Supporting Statistics: Why HVAC Maintenance Matters
HVAC Systems Use a Lot of Energy
Heating and cooling make up 50% of home energy use (RPSC - DOE).
Neglected systems waste energy, leading to higher bills.
Regular Maintenance Cuts Costs
Proper maintenance reduces energy expenses by 5-20% annually (Better Buildings - DOE).
Simple fixes like coil cleaning and duct sealing improve efficiency.
Delayed Repairs Cost More
3 million HVAC systems are replaced yearly in the U.S.
Homeowners spend $14 billion annually on HVAC repairs (RPSC - DOE).
Ignoring minor issues leads to expensive breakdowns.

Frequently Asked Questions
How Often Should I Schedule HVAC Maintenance?
Schedule HVAC maintenance at least twice annually. This ensures systems operate efficiently, avoiding expensive repairs while prolonging lifespan. Regular check-ups maintain home comfort throughout the year.
What Are Common Signs My HVAC Needs Repair?
Unusual noises from an HVAC system often signal a need for repair. Warm air blowing instead of cool air also indicates a problem. Frequent cycling can suggest underlying issues that require attention. Strange odors or rising energy bills may point to additional concerns as well.
Can I Perform HVAC Repairs Myself?
Attempting minor HVAC repairs, such as changing filters or cleaning vents, is possible. Complex issues typically need professional assistance. If uncertainty or discomfort arises, calling an expert helps prevent further damage.
How Long Does an HVAC Repair Typically Take?
HVAC repairs vary in time, with most common issues requiring one to four hours. Complex problems may take longer, so preparing for such cases is wise during repairs.
What Should I Do During a HVAC Emergency?
In an HVAC emergency, first, turn off the system to avoid more damage. Look for clear problems such as leaks or blockages. After assessing the situation, contact a professional for quick help. Stay safe and keep calm.
